Students drew on desks with Sharpie. Is there a way to remove it without ruining the laminate finish?
Yes – try these methods in order, from gentlest to strongest.
| Method | Effectiveness | Risk to Laminate |
|---|---|---|
| Dry erase marker over Sharpie (then wipe) | Good for fresh marks | None |
| Rubbing alcohol (70%) on cloth | Excellent | Very low |
| Hand sanitizer (gel) let sit 1 min then wipe | Good | Low |
| Magic eraser (damp) | Good for surface stains | Can dull gloss finish |
| Nail polish remover (acetone-free) | Last resort | May damage – test first |
| Baking soda paste (gentle scrub) | Fair | Low |
Meet&Co's Pro tip: For desk surfaces, use isopropyl alcohol first. Wipe with microfiber cloth. Don't soak – laminate edges can swell. After removal, apply a thin layer of car wax to make future graffiti easier to wipe off.
